History, asked by meenakaur15, 8 months ago

explain the role of women in France before and after the revolution

Answer:

Women played as significant role in bringing about the French Revolution. They participated in the 'March to Versailles' to get the king sign 'The Declaration of the Rights of the Man'. They also participated in the fall of bastille. ... Before the revolution women had a very poor status.

The role of women in France before and after the revolution given below:

Explanation:

  • The role of women before the revolution played little role in society and the public.
  • Women followed the traditional role.
  • After marriage, women maintain household work and look after her husband.
  • They had no role in politics as they hold no right in making decisions.
  • After the revolution, women role in France changed as they began to vote and hold few positions in the government.
  • Women organised clubs and groups which tried to look after their social status along with improving laws and reform that would lead women to hold equal rights as men.
